N-(4-fluoro-3-nitrophenyl)acetamide is a chemical compound with a molecular structure that features a fluoro-substituted nitrophenyl group connected to an acetamide backbone. It is recognized for its potential as a building block in the development of drugs and functional materials, as well as for its ant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ties, positioning it as a promising candidate for new therapeutic agents.

351-32-6 Usage

Uses

Used in Organic Synthesis:
N-(4-fluoro-3-nitrophenyl)acetamide is used as a building block in organic synthesis for the creation of various functional materials and compounds due to its unique molecular structure and reactivity.
Used in Pharmaceutical Research:
In pharmaceutical research, N-(4-fluoro-3-nitrophenyl)acetamide is utilized as a precursor in drug development, leveraging its chemical properties to contribute to the discovery of new therapeutic agents.
Used in Antimicrobial Applications:
N-(4-fluoro-3-nitrophenyl)acetamide is employed as an antimicrobial agent, capitalizing on its ability to combat microbial infections, making it a valuable component in the development of new antimicrobial drugs.
Used in Anti-inflammatory Applications:
Due to its anti-inflammatory properties, N-(4-fluoro-3-nitrophenyl)acetamide is used in the development of anti-inflammatory medications, potentially offering new treatment options for inflammatory conditions.
It is crucial to handle N-(4-fluoro-3-nitrophenyl)acetamide with care and adhere to safety protocols to mitigate any health and environmental risks associated with its use.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 351-32-6 includes 6 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 3 digits, 3,5 and 1 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 3 and 2 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 351-32:
(5*3)+(4*5)+(3*1)+(2*3)+(1*2)=46
46 % 10 = 6
So 351-32-6 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Potential of 2-Chloro-N-(4-fluoro-3-nitrophenyl)acetamide against Klebsiella pneumoniae and in Vitro Toxicity Analysis

Andrade-Júnior, Francisco,Athayde-Filho, Petr?nio,Barbosa-Filho, José,Cordeiro, Laísa,Diniz-Neto, Hermes,Ferreira, Elba,Figueiredo, Pedro,Lima, Edeltrudes,Melo, Thamara,Oliveira, Rafael,Oliveira-Filho, Abrah?o,Sousa, Aleson,Souza, Helivaldo

, (2020)

Klebsiella pneumoniae causes a wide range of community and nosocomial infections. The high capacity of this pathogen to acquire resistance drugs makes it necessary to develop therapeutic alternatives, discovering new antibacterial molecules. Acetamides are molecules that have several biological activities. However, there are no reports on the activity of 2-chloro-N-(4-fluoro-3-nitrophenyl)acetamide. Based on this, this study aimed to investigate the in vitro antibacterial activity of this molecule on K. pneumoniae, evaluating whether the presence of the chloro atom improves this effect. Then, analyzing its antibacterial action more thoroughly, as well as its cytotoxic and pharmacokinetic profile, in order to contribute to future studies for the viability of a new antibacterial drug. It was shown that the substance has good potential against K. pneumoniae and the chloro atom is responsible for improving this activity, stabilizing the molecule in the target enzyme at the site. The substance possibly acts on penicillin-binding protein, promoting cell lysis. The analysis of cytotoxicity and mutagenicity shows favorable results for future in vivo toxicological tests to be carried out, with the aim of investigating the potential of this molecule. In addition, the substance showed an excellent pharmacokinetic profile, indicating good parameters for oral use.

Discovery, SAR and X-ray structure of 1H-benzimidazole-5-carboxylic acid cyclohexyl-methyl-amides as inhibitors of inducible T-cell kinase (Itk)

Moriarty, Kevin J.,Takahashi, Hidenori,Pullen, Steven S.,Khine, Hnin Hnin,Sallati, Rosemarie H.,Raymond, Ernest L.,Woska Jr., Joseph R.,Jeanfavre, Deborah D.,Roth, Gregory P.,Winters, Michael P.,Qiao, Lei,Ryan, Declan,DesJarlais, Renee,Robinson, Darius,Wilson, Matthew,Bobko, Mark,Cook, Brian N.,Lo, Ho Yin,Nemoto, Peter A.,Kashem, Mohammed A.,Wolak, John P.,White, André,Magolda, Ronald L.,Tomczuk, Bruce

scheme or table, p. 5545 - 5549 (2009/06/18)

A series of novel potent benzimidazole based inhibitors of interleukin-2 T-cell kinase (Itk) were prepared. In this report, we discuss the structure-activity relationship (SAR), selectivity, and cell-based activity for the series. We also discuss the SAR associated with an X-ray structure of one of the small-molecule inhibitors bound to ITK.
